Pair of lady's slippers

A pair of lady's square toed slippers dark brown kid lined wtih light blue silk taffeta, heeless, edge bound with light blue silk ribbon with ruching of pale blue ribbon at instep, palmette-like design on toe in part cut away to show light blue satin back

  • Title: Pair of women's slippers Overall view
  • Date Created: 1845
  • Physical Dimensions: 6 x 7 x 24.7 cm (2 3/8 x 2 3/4 x 9 3/4 in.)
  • Type: Shoes
  • Rights: Gift of Miss Gertrude H. Shurtleff. Museum of Fine Arts, Boston. All Rights Reserved.
  • Medium: Leather, silk taffeta, and silk tambour embroidery
